Tennis Set to Compete at Hoosier Classic

Oct. 5, 2006

BLOOMINGTON, Ind. — The University of Kansas tennis team will continue its fall season this weekend when it travels to Bloomington, Ind., for the Hoosier Classic. The event will run Friday through Sunday, and features some of the nation’s top programs, including LSU, Notre Dame, and host-school Indiana.

The Classic consists of four singles brackets along with two round-robin singles tournaments.

This weekend will mark the first action of the year for 2006 All-Big 12 selection Elizaveta Avdeeva, who did not compete in Kansas’ first event of the fall.

KU is coming off a strong showing at the Deacon Classic, which was highlighted by sophomore Yuliana Svistun’s championship in the flight D singles bracket.

The Hoosier Classic is the second of four events that make up the fall schedule for the Jayhawks. Following this weekend, KU will compete in the ITA Central Regionals and the North Carolina Tournament before opening up its spring match season in late January.
